I am a new user to Resolve, long time user of Corel Pinnacle Studio products, my usage is completely non-commercial (family activities, travel, special occasions), currently plowing through the user manual, on-line training resources, any other info I can get...and making some progress.

But I did just encounter an issue, possibly a Windows 10 issue (but it literally just raised its ugly head today, and I used Resolve extensively yesterday). I checked, and my pc did not receive any MS Windows updates for at least a week.

I cannot minimize my screen when using Resolve. I literally have to either shut Resolve down or invoke task manager to switch to another program. Pressing the ESC key does not work, bouncing the mouse arrow down or up (or any other way), does not allow me to minimize Resolve and access another app (so, I have Resolve open, I want to access the user manual, then back to Resolve...no luck). As you might imagine this creates a real problem if I want to go from the user manual, or an on-line tutorial, then back to Resolve.

Any help, suggestions, or direction is much appreciated.

In the Workspace drop down menu uncheck Full Screen Window. You should now have the Windows bar at the top of your screen.
